GNU/Linux >> Linux の 問題 >  >> Cent OS

CentOS 7 / RHEL 7 に MySQL 5.6 をインストールする

このチュートリアルでは、CentOS 7 / RHEL 7 に MySQL 5.6 をインストールする方法について、迅速かつ簡単な方法を探ります。以前に、CentOS 6 / RHEL 7 に MySQL Server 5.6 をインストールする方法について既に説明しました。

CentOS および RHEL 7 には、デフォルトで MariaDB が付属しています。 MariaDB は、古い MySQL Server を Oracle から置き換えるために使用されるデータベース標準デーモンです。 MariaDB は元の MySQL サーバーの創設者によって作成され、従来の MySQL バージョンよりも SQL クエリとデータベース サーバーのパフォーマンスが大幅に向上しています。

ただし、MySQL Server をデフォルトのデータベース サーバーとして使用している企業はまだあります。これは、ある顧客の専用サーバーの 1 つに当てはまりました。彼は、CentOS 7 で MySQL 5.6 のみを使用するように要求しました。手順は次のとおりです。

CentOS 7 に MySQL 5.6 をインストールする

まず、システムが最新であることを確認してください:

yum update -y

すべてのパッケージが更新されたら、MySQL Server Community Edition のインストールを続けましょう。

MariaDB を削除

次のコマンドを実行して、サーバーから MariaDB を削除します:

yum remove mariadb mariadb-server -y

MySQL コミュニティ リポジトリをインストール

CentOS 7 に MySQL 5.6 をインストールするには、公式の MySQL コミュニティ リポジトリをダウンロードしてインストールする必要があります。次のコマンドを実行します:

rpm -Uvh http://repo.mysql.com/mysql-community-release-el7-5.noarch.rpm sudo rpm -ivh mysql-community-release-el7-5.noarch.rpm

MySQL サーバーをインストール

次に、以下に示すように、yum を使用して MySQL クライアントと MySQL サーバーをインストールします。

yum install mysql mysql-server

MySQL を起動し、起動後に自動起動を有効にする

MySQL 5.6 サーバーを起動し、ブート プロセス中に起動できるようにします。

systemctl start mysqld
systemctl enable mysqld

安全な MySQL サーバー

これで、MySQL セキュリティ スクリプトを実行して、サーバーが確実に強化されるようにしましょう。このために、MySQL サーバーをインストールするたびに実行する必要がある mysql_secure_installation スクリプトを使用します。このスクリプトを root として実行するだけです:

mysql_secure_installation

MySQL クライアントとサーバーが動作していることを確認してください

次のコマンドを実行します:

[[email protected]:~]mysql -V
mysql Ver 14.14 Distrib 5.6.35, for Linux (x86_64) using EditLine wrapper
[[email protected]:~]

root として MySQL サーバーに接続してみてください:

mysql -u root -p
[[email protected]:~]mysql -u root -p
Enter password: 
Welcome to the MySQL monitor.  Commands end with ; or \g.
Your MySQL connection id is 249979
Server version: 5.6.35 MySQL Community Server (GPL)

Copyright (c) 2000, 2016, Oracle and/or its affiliates. All rights reserved.

Oracle is a registered trademark of Oracle Corporation and/or its
affiliates. Other names may be trademarks of their respective
owners.

Type 'help;' or '\h' for help. Type '\c' to clear the current input statement.

mysql>

これですべてです。この時点で、CentOS 7 / RHEL 7 で MySQL 5.6 が問題なく動作するはずです。

CentOS 7 に MySQL 5.6 をインストール / RHEL 7 が最後に変更されました:2017 年 3 月 31 日 Esteban Borges
Cent OS
  1. CentOSにMySQLServer5.6をインストールします

  2. CentOS8にMySQL8データベースサーバーをインストールする方法

  3. CentOS7にMySQLサーバーをインストールする方法

  1. CentOS7にPerconaサーバーをインストールする方法

  2. CentOS 8 /RHEL8にPuppetをインストールする方法

  3. CentOS 6 /RHEL6にownCloudをインストールする

  1. RHEL 8 /CentOS8にvncサーバーをインストールする方法

  2. NextcloudをRHEL8/CentOS8サーバーにインストールする方法

  3. RHEL 8 /CentOS8サーバーにOwnCloudをインストールする方法